1. Smart Integration: Seamless Tech Meets Style
Smart home technology continues to revolutionize every corner of the home, and door handles are at the forefront of this shift. The 2025 trend isn’t just about “smart locks”—it’s about invisible tech integration that doesn’t sacrifice style for functionality. Homeowners are ditching clunky, gadget-like smart handles in favor of sleek designs that blend seamlessly with their decor.
Leading brands like Schlage are pioneering this trend with innovations like the Schlage Sense Pro™ Smart Deadbolt, which uses ultra-wideband technology for hands-free unlocking. This cutting-edge design detects your approach, calculates your trajectory, and unlocks the door precisely as you reach it—no fumbling with keys or phones required. For first-time smart lock users, the Schlage Arrive™ Smart WiFi Deadbolt offers built-in WiFi connectivity (no extra accessories needed) and remote access management via a user-friendly app, supporting up to 250 custom access codes.

2. Warm Metallics & Earthy Finishes
Cold, shiny chrome is out—warm, earthy metal finishes are taking center stage in 2025. Designers and homeowners alike are gravitating toward finishes that add depth, character, and a timeless feel, such as oil-rubbed bronze, unlacquered brass, and antique patinas. These hues age gracefully over time, developing unique patinas that give each handle a one-of-a-kind look.
Matte black remains a staple for those who prefer a bold, modern aesthetic, but it’s now being paired with warmer tones for a layered effect. For example, a matte black entry handle with brass accents can create a striking contrast that works in both industrial and Scandinavian-style homes. Satin nickel is also gaining popularity for its soft, smooth finish that resists scratches and pairs well with nearly any interior color palette.
These warm metallic finishes complement natural materials like wood, stone, and linen, making them ideal for creating cohesive, organic-looking spaces. Whether you’re updating a vintage home or a modern condo, these finishes add a touch of luxury without feeling over-the-top.
3. Minimalist Profiles with Maximum Impact
Minimalism isn’t going anywhere in 2025—and door handles are embracing the “less is more” philosophy. Clean lines, concealed fasteners, and subtle detailing are key features of this trend, which focuses on creating a sense of calm and clarity in the home. Narrow levers, edge pulls, and recessed handles (flush with the door surface) are particularly popular for sliding doors and glass doors, as they keep the focus on the door’s material and design rather than the hardware.
The beauty of minimalist handles lies in their versatility. They work in everything from modern lofts to transitional homes, and their understated design ensures they won’t clash with other decor elements. Even in minimalist spaces, though, functionality isn’t compromised—these handles are ergonomically designed for comfort, with softly curved forms that replace sharp angles for a warmer touch.

5. Mix-and-Match Styles for Personalization
Gone are the days of matching door handles throughout the entire home. 2025 is all about personalization, and designers are encouraging homeowners to mix and match styles, finishes, and materials to create a custom look. For example, a classic crystal knob in the powder room can add a touch of elegance, while a sleek modern lever in the living room keeps the space feeling contemporary.
This trend allows you to express your personality and tailor each room’s hardware to its function. Entryways, for instance, can feature bold, oversized handles that make a strong first impression (a key trend in 2025), while bedroom handles can be more delicate and decorative. Many brands now offer mix-and-match options, allowing you to combine knobs, levers, and rosettes to create a unique look that’s all your own.
